Trying to replace turbocharger but panel is missing!! HELP PLEASE!!!! 900 1991

Hi im farely new at this but i think i have a pretty good question and have been calling around for 3 weeks trying to figure this out. I have a 91 940T that the turbo charger went out on recently. It burned out a full tank of oil in 2 weeks and is embarrassing to drive there is so much smoke. I went to buy a new or rebuilt one but the plate on the part that tells if its a garrett or mitsubishi is gone. theres nothing there no numbers or anything. I figured they would all come with one type that year but no one seems to know and the dealer here doesnt seem to want to help me. Is there anyway to figure this one out? A number maybe on the big hose next to it or on that clamp??? I just figured most of you all on here know alot more about this stuff than any mechanic so thanks a bunch!
